CVS Health is expanding its pharmacy offering to include pet medications (antibiotics, allergy, flea/tick control, insulin, pain relievers) across ~9,000 locations nationwide, with digital integration into the CVS app and electronic prescription capabilities coming soon.

Leadership read: The operational weight here is not the pet medications themselves; it is the profile extension. By allowing customers to add pets to their CVS health profile alongside human family members, CVS has committed to a unified health-data architecture that spans species. That is a materially different data and regulatory problem than adding a product SKU. Electronic prescription routing between veterinary practices and retail pharmacies introduces a new class of prescriber relationship, a different DEA and state-board compliance surface, and interoperability requirements that the existing human-pharmacy tech stack was not built to handle. The company has effectively created a new channel to veterinary practices that requires its own integration and commercial maintenance. CVS Health announced expansion of GLP-1 weight-loss medication support across U.S. pharmacies and MinuteClinics, driving 3% stock increase.

Leadership read: CVS has committed itself to a clinical-service model, not merely a dispensing one. Expanding GLP-1 support through MinuteClinics means the company is now promising adherence counseling, dosing titration support, and likely insurance navigation at scale, functions that sit structurally outside a traditional pharmacy operating model. That commitment changes the staffing and workflow logic of both the clinic and pharmacy networks simultaneously, requiring care coordination between two operating units that have historically run in parallel rather than in series. CVS Health announced expanded GLP-1 weight management medication coverage options across commercial formularies

Leadership read: The operational shift here is not coverage expansion in the conventional sense. CVS Caremark has restructured formulary architecture to make GLP-1 medications a durable line item rather than a carved-out specialty exception. That distinction matters because formulary placement determines how PBM rebate negotiations, tier positioning, and step-therapy protocols are written for every commercial plan sponsor on those formularies. CVS has effectively committed its commercial book to a new affordability logic for an entire drug class, which reorders its relationship with both manufacturers and plan sponsors simultaneously.
